首页 > 其他分享 >pycharm中matplotlib 画图后图片卡住问题的解决

pycharm中matplotlib 画图后图片卡住问题的解决

时间:2023-02-19 20:22:42浏览次数:35  
标签:画图 matplotlib 卡住 解决 pycharm backend

目录

问题

以前使用pycharm python matplotlib 画图的时候,可以画好多可以交互的图,像matlab一样,但从某一时刻开始,pycharm设置改了哪里,只要使用matplotlib一画那种弹出来的图就卡,一直没有解决。
今天无聊中又尝试了下,解决了,现在说解决方法。

解决方案

在代码中加入

matplotlib.use("Qt5Agg")   # 修改配置的后端 backend 注意 matplotlib.use("Agg")没用

加入后画图可以不用 plt.show()来弹出图了,直接就会出来

想要新图就使用plt.figure()来增加新图

这样图就不会卡住了,可以使用放大缩小来看图了。

本质理解

本质是去理解 matplotlibrc和backend的设置

标签:画图,matplotlib,卡住,解决,pycharm,backend
From: https://www.cnblogs.com/Nicoooolas/p/17135485.html

相关文章

  • python--matplotlib(1)
    前言 Matplotlib画图工具的官网地址是http://matplotlib.org/Python环境下实现Matlab制图功能的第三方库,需要numpy库的支持,支持用户方便设计出二维、三维数据的图形显示。......
  • 软件测试|matplotlib中文不显示的解决方案
    前言当我使用matplotlib结合wordcloud,jieba绘制词云图时,发现我的代码在没有任何报错的情况下,输出的图是下面这样的,我想了很多办法都不顶用,包括改编码方式等等,后面一查,是matp......
  • 一笔画图形的判断方式
    一、笔画的概念1、一笔画是讨论某图形是否可以一笔画出。图形中任何端点根据所连接线条数被分为奇点、偶点。只有所有点为偶点的图形和只有两个奇点的图形一定可以一笔画......
  • IDEA/PyCharm设置代理功能
    参考步骤测试结果......
  • pycharm
    header设置File->Settings->Editor->FileandCodeTemplates->PythonScript#!/usr/bin/envpython#-*-coding:utf-8-*-#@Date:${DATE}${TIME}#@Author......
  • matplotlib3常见图形的绘制
    importmatplotlib.pyplotaspltimportrandomfrompylabimportmpl设置显示中文字体mpl.rcParams["font.sans-serif"]=["SimHei"]设置正常显示符号mpl.rcParams......
  • pycharm配置opencv库
    我走的弯路:对于刚刚入手OpenCV的小白,又第一次接触pycharm编译器。所以在配置opencv库的时候遇到很多问题。如下:1、如果直接在Terminal运行界面输入【pipinstallopencv-p......
  • pycharm的基本操作数据类型
      prcharm的基础操作1.切换版本翻译器file-settings-project-interpeter注释1.单行注释添加注释:#加上需要添加的注释快捷键:ctrl+?自动进行格式化code-reforma......
  • pycharm的使用与常量变量
    常量与变量pycharm软件的基本使用#1.下载与安装#2.pycharm的语言,一定要使用英文的#修改主题背景File settings Apperance Theme#修改字体......
  • matplotlib中图示的参数设置
       当使用python的matplotlib包的时候,我们可以使用legend命令来绘制图示.legend命令的可配置参数具体可见此处(https://matplotlib.org/3.3.2/api/_as_gen/matplot......